An Overview of the New Plans
Comcast's national video plans aim to consolidate various entertainment options into a single, straightforward package. This approach reflects a larger trend in the industry towards simplifying content access for consumers. Here's what you need to know:
- Pricing: One flat fee for a variety of content, eliminating the need for multiple subscriptions.
- Content Variety: Includes live TV, on-demand options, and streaming services.
- Ease of Access: User-friendly interface that allows customers to navigate content seamlessly.

Competing in the Streaming Age
In a world where consumers are increasingly turning to streaming services like Netflix and Hulu, traditional cable faces mounting challenges. Comcast's venture into simplified video plans is a strategic response to this competitive landscape. By offering a more cohesive viewing experience, they may regain some market share from digital competitors.
